By applying the familiar premise to a new and original setting \u2013 specifically the Comanche nation in 1719 \u2013 but otherwise adopting a rather refreshing back-to-basics approach that does away with convoluted plot contrivances in favour of a simple, pared-down narrative, the film overwhelmingly succeeds. It\u2019s a consistently engaging, edge-of-your-seat affair \u2013 with a brilliant lead performance, several terrific action sequences, and a well-judged emotional throughline.<\/p> <p>The central figure in the story is Naru (Midthunder), a skilled warrior who is constantly undermined by the male members of her tribe. Despite her clear expertise, none of her companions are willing to accept that she should join them on their hunting mission, but join them she does \u2013 and just as well, it turns out. While the men think they\u2019re going to encounter nothing more dangerous than a mountain lion on their travels \u2013 a difficult task, but by no means beyond their capabilities \u2013 Naru is the only one to clock that something far more deadly is in their midst. That something, it\u2019s no spoiler to say, is the Predator \u2013 a highly evolved, extremely vicious extra-terrestrial who has come to Earth for the very first time to hunt humans for sport.<\/p>\n<p>And so, after we witness the Predator brutally dispatch a number of smaller creatures \u2013 look away, animal lovers \u2013 the battle begins. Much of the action in the middle section pitches Naru directly against the beast, such that it essentially becomes a two-hander \u2013 eventually building up to a bigger showdown when some French-speaking fur-trappers get caught up in the carnage. The whole thing is perfectly paced, taking its time to build up the tension rather than front-loading massive action set-pieces \u2013 and Midthunder is a magnetic presence throughout, aided by her loveable dog sidekick.<\/p>\n<p>Even if the narrative is straightforward, Prey\u2019s setting allows it to really stand out when compared to other films in the franchise. A huge amount of research went into authentically recreating the historical period and accurately portraying the Comanche nation, and the result is something that feels genuinely unique. It\u2019s also tremendous fun to see the Predator go up against other large animals \u2013 even if some of the CGI is a little unconvincing in these sections \u2013 while it\u2019s interesting to see a battle against the beast that uses rather primitive weapons, a far cry from the barrage of machine gunfire we\u2019ve seen it face in the past.<\/p>\n<iframe title=\"&quot;Prey\" official=\"\" trailer=\"\" hulu=\"\" width=\"&quot;200&quot;\" height=\"&quot;113&quot;\" src=\"&quot;https:\/\/www.youtube.com\/embed\/wZ7LytagKlc?feature=oembed&quot;\" frameborder=\"&quot;0&quot;\" allow=\"&quot;accelerometer;\" autoplay=\"\" clipboard-write=\"\" encrypted-media=\"\" gyroscope=\"\" picture-in-picture=\"\" allowfullscreen=\"\"\/>\n<p>It also helps that the film looks consistently brilliant from start to finish. The whole shoot was done using only natural light, and just like the first Predator film it unfolds entirely in outdoor, natural locations \u2013 which helps to give it that wild, feral quality that so defined the original. There\u2019s also some wonderfully gruesome imagery \u2013 including an entire field\u2019s worth of massacred buffalos \u2013 not to mention some brilliantly inventive kills, which does a lot to ensure the film feels appropriately nasty and by no means a sanitised version of the Predator story.<\/p>\n<p>Fans of the franchise will also be delighted to see several allusions to other films in the series \u2013 whether that be set pieces that serve as parallels to previous scenes or familiar lines of dialogue, and thankfully these moments of homage never feel too shoe-horned in.
